Ideal for adsorption of larger molecular impurities. Our Molecular Sieve Beads 10A are used as static beds in gas and liquid process streams to selectively sequester impurities smaller than 1 nanometer (10Å = 1nm). The beads’ active sites are functionally polar in character which attracts entrained molecules by their dipole moments, capturing the most polarized within the aluminosilicate structure. Featuring a size range of 1.7–2.4mm in diameter, Molecular Sieve Beads 10A are compressed and thermally hardened spherical pellets of Type 13X zeolite with sodium cations and a buffered alkaline pH of 10.3. Molecules enter the crystalline lattice through pores measuring 10 angstroms (Å), accessing a vast internal network of ionically polarized adsorption sites.
